Many modern residences utilize an electric hot water heater for their heater, due to its comfort and convenience of use. However, similar to any other electrical home appliances, troubles may develop with its use, unexpectedly. It can be truly irritating to awaken to a cool shower as opposed to a warm one or having your bathroom with water that isn't warm sufficient and even as well hot. Whatever the case might be, hot water heater issues can be quite nerve-racking. Thankfully, we have actually made a checklist of possible solutions to your hot water heater issues. There are a variety of elements that can trigger a number of these problems, it could be an concern with the power supply, the electrical burner, or the thermostat. Before doing anything, guarantee you shut off the main power supply for security. Whatever the trouble is, getting it repaired need to not pose excessive of an concern if you adhere to these steps:
Examine Your Power Supply: As fundamental as this may appear, it is extremely necessary. Without ample power, your water heater will not function. So the first thing to do when your water all of a sudden retires is to verify that it isn't a power trouble. Inspect if the fuse is burnt out or the circuit breaker stumbled. If the breaker is the issue, simply turn it on and off once more. Replace any type of broken or worn-out fuse. Evaluate the device with power after these adjustments to see if it's currently functioning.
Examine the Burner in the Hot Water Heater: If it's not a power trouble, after that try having a look at your heating element if it is still functioning. Test each of your burner to be sure the issue isn't with any one of them. If any of them is damaged, replace that part and afterwards check whether the hot water is back on.
Inspect Your Thermostat: If your hot water heater still isn't working or the water appearing isn't hot sufficient, you may require to check the temperature level setups on your upper thermostat. Ensure the circuit breaker is turned off prior to doing anything. Open the gain access to panel and press the red button for temperature level reset over the thermostat. This should aid warm the water. Transform the circuit breaker back on and also check if the issue has actually been solved.
Call A Professional: If after changing all damaged parts and also resetting your temperature, the hot water heater still isn't functioning, you may require to speak to an professional plumbing technician for a professional point of view. The problem with your heating system could be that the hot and cold faucets have actually been switched or it might be undersized for the amount of hot water required in your home. Whatever the situation might be, a specialist plumbing would certainly help resolve the trouble.
Final thought
Hot water heater troubles are not constantly significant. A lot of them are because of minor problems like a blown fuse or worn-out heating element. Replacing the defective parts must suffice. If you are still unable to resolve the problem, offer a telephone call to your closest plumbing to come to obtain it repaired.

Pipes Tips That Are Handy To Anybody



Excellent plumbing upkeep is reasonably easy, yet failing to keep up with it can mean expensive fixings. Here are some excellent ways you can deal with your pipes, either yourself or with the help of a certified specialist. Care for your house now and it will beneift you in the future.

When you wash your hands, make sure that you have not left any soap on the faucet handles. What individuals do not know is that leaving soap on these components can trigger fixtures to corrode. Simply take 2 seconds after you are done washing your hands to get rid of excess soap from the manages.

Plunging is not the only means to unclog a troublesome commode. If the water in the basin is resting low and also you understand there's a obstruction, try going down hot water straight into the container with a little bit of altitude, to use enough pressure to aid move along the clog.

As appealing maybe to try and minimize the home heating bill, keep your heating system established no less than 55 levels over the winter to prevent inside pipes from freezing. If you have pipes located in an excessively chilly basement, think about running a space heater in the cellar, however just when it can be looked at often.

Utilize a hairdryer to thaw frozen pipes, after you shut off the water to the house. A hairdryer will gently warm the pipeline and thaw the ice without causing substantial damages to the pipe. Shutting down the water first means that if the pipeline is broken, there will certainly be no rush of water right into the house.

Prior to starting any kind of plumbing job by yourself make sure to do a large amount of research. There are several resources offered to aid you in understanding your plumbing system as well as aid you to avoid numerous typical blunders made by diy novices. Reading about other people's errors can make the distinction of conserving or shedding money.

Drain the debris from all-time low of your warm water heating unit two times a year to keep the hot water heater working at its optimum degrees. Merely open up the drain valve and also enable the water to run out right into a pail up until the water runs clear. Shut the drain valve.

If your pipelines are prone to freezing, allow the water trickle continually in a minimum of one faucet throughout weather that is below freezing. This will minimize the possibilities that the pipelines will ice up and also leave you without water. If water is continuously running through the pipes and also trickling out of a faucet, the pipes are much less most likely to ice up.

If you have problems with a slow drain, there are less complicated points you can do other than removing the pipes to clean it. There are certain devices made just for this purpose that you insert into the drainpipe to loosen the blockage so it removes or get it as well as remove it entirely.

As stated over, a lot of routine pipes maintenance is easy and uncomplicated. The majority of fixings arising from severe damage to your pipes are not. Since you know just how to take care of the plubming problems in your home, you need to be much more ready to avoid or mitigate the extra severe problems that can result.
